Security Officer

Allied Universal

As a Security Officer Screening Agent in Greenwood, IN,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Tech/Media/Telecom, and more. As a Screener in a dynamic tech and telecommunications location, you will help monitor access points, screen visitors and team members, and support security-related protocols with professionalism and care. This role offers the chance to stay visible, provide strong customer service and communication, and contribute to a welcoming environment. At Allied Universal, you will be part of an agile, reliable, and innovative team that puts people first and acts with integrity. Position Type: Full Time Pay Rate: $17.75 / Hour Job Schedule DayTimeMon06:00 AM - 02:00 PMFri06:00 AM - 02:00 PMSat06:00 AM - 02:00 PMSun06:00 AM - 02:00 PM What You'll Do Provide customer service by carrying out site-specific screening procedures, access protocols, and emergency response activities at a fast-paced technology location.Screen employees, visitors, contractors, and/or deliveries in accordance with post orders and site policies, and report unusual activity or policy concerns to site leadership.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, helping to support a professional environment during alarms, access issues, and/or other security-related events.Monitor entry points, credential checks, and visitor processing activities, helping to deter unauthorized access and support orderly movement throughout the location.Conduct regular and random patrols around assigned areas and the perimeter as directed, and complete logs, incident reports, and other required documentation related to daily security-related activity. Minimum Requirements CPR certification is preferred.Access control and badge experience is preferred.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.
